Evaluating Cannabis Impairment: Standardized Field Sobriety Tests
Assessing intoxication from cannabis presents a challenge, as it manifests differently in individuals. Authorities often rely on standardized field sobriety tests (SFSTs) to evaluate potential cannabis effect. These assessments are intended to measure multiple aspects of motor skills, which can be impacted by the presence of cannabis in the system.
While SFSTs have proven to be effective in detecting alcohol influence, their reliability in identifying cannabis impairment is subject to ongoing research. This is because influences individuals in various ways, and the effects can be similar to those of other factors
- However, SFSTs remain a valuable tool in the determination of potential cannabis impairment.
- Additionally, combining SFST results with other factors, such as observational evidence, can strengthen the accuracy of the evaluation.

Identifying Marijuana Consumption| Advanced Testing Methods for Employers
Employers seeking to evaluate employee marijuana consumption now have access to advanced testing methods. Traditional urine tests, while once common, often lack the sensitivity to separate recent use from long-term exposure.
Luckily, new methods offer greater accuracy. Hair follicle testing, for instance, can detect marijuana use across a longer period. Saliva tests provide immediate results and are less invasive than urine screening.
Additionally, blood tests offer the highest level of accuracy, indicating marijuana use within a short frame before testing. Employers should thoroughly consider the advantages and drawbacks of each testing method to select the option that best fulfills their unique needs.
Understanding Cannabis Intoxication Tests: Accuracy vs. Reliability
Determining if someone is impaired by cannabis can be a difficult task. Several factors can influence the accuracy of intoxication tests, making it important to understand the principles behind these tests.
Saliva tests are commonly used to detect cannabis metabolites in an individual's body. However, the timeframe during which these substances remain detectable can vary widely depending on factors such as consumption habits, body chemistry, and sample type.
- Adding to the complexity are issues related to ability to detect cannabis metabolites at low concentrations, as well as the possibility of incorrect readings due to cross-reactivity with other substances.
- Moreover, the evaluation of test results often requires expert knowledge to factor in individual circumstances and other influences.
Ongoing research aims to improve the validity of cannabis intoxication tests by refining testing methods and defining more precise threshold values for metabolite detection.
